The purpose of this role is to support the marketing team by improving video turnaround times and overall output. The primary responsibility would be video editing and social media management. This includes editing content to a high standard and managing the uploading and scheduling of content across platforms.

About the Employer

Founded in 2008, is an award‑winning estate agency in Yorkshire, specializing in residential sales, lettings, and financial services in Leeds, York, Selby, and Doncaster. They are known for a “dedicated personal agent” model, where one person handles the entire process to provide bespoke service.

How to prepare for a job interview at GetMyFirstJob Ltd

Show Off Your Editing Skills

Before the interview, make sure to prepare a portfolio showcasing your video editing work. Highlight projects where you’ve improved turnaround times or enhanced content quality. This will demonstrate your practical skills and creativity, which are crucial for the role.

Know Your Social Media Platforms

Familiarise yourself with the different social media platforms the company uses. Be ready to discuss how you would manage and schedule content effectively across these channels. Showing that you understand the nuances of each platform can set you apart from other candidates.

Brush Up on Communication Skills

Since this role involves teamwork and communication,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. Think of examples where you've successfully collaborated with others or communicated ideas effectively. This will help you convey your fit for the team-oriented environment.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are some thoughtful questions about the company's marketing strategies or future projects.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the company aligns with your career goals. Plus, it gives you a chance to engage with the interviewers.
